    A trailer loaded with cargo erupted in flames early Thursday morning at the Berger New Garage area of the Lagos-Ibadan Expressway, leading to severe congestion on the inward-Lagos lane. The incident occurred around 5:50 a.m., and although the contents of the trailer were still unknown, emergency teams from LASTMA quickly responded to the scene.

    Did you know that unapproved gated streets can disrupt public access? The Lagos government has issued a warning that gates or barriers on public roads must remain open from 5:00 AM to 11:00 PM daily. This is crucial for ensuring everyone can travel freely, especially during peak hours.

  • 🚨 Accidents can happen in the blink of an eye! A recent incident in Lagos serves as a stark reminder. A speeding CNG truck crashed into a private vehicle at Apakun Bridge, leaving two pedestrians injured. The chaos unfolded as the heavy-duty truck collided with a silver Toyota Corolla, causing a chain reaction that no one saw coming.
